Be Energy Efficient
If you're selling your home then foulden buyers will be looking for energy efficient properties, as these will be cheaper to run, and easier to sell.
A good foulden estate agent will be able to advise you and point you in the right direction for making your home more energy efficient.
An energy assessor will come and assess your property for a current and potential Energy Efficiency Rating and a current and potential Environmental (CO2) Impact Rating. This will be included in your HIP pack, which must be completed before you market your property.
Bully Your Estate Agent
Dont rely on your estate agent in the area of foulden, to put the required effort into drawing up the sales particulars and populating the Window Card details. Always scrutinise what they have prepared and don't be frightened to request that they make changes to these items if you feel that they haven't put the required effort into this work.
